Sarwat Nasir

Sarwat Nasir

Space Editor
UAE
Sarwat is the space editor at The National and oversees the space coverage at the organisation. She has a keen interest in human spaceflight, private space industry and interplanetary missions. A graduate of Murdoch University, she joined The National in 2020. She previously worked with Khaleej Times and 7Days covering space and education.
